摘要
As part of an international collaboration to measure the low-frequency spectrum of the cosmic microwave background (CMB) radiation, we have measured its temperature at a frequency of 3.8 GHz (7.9 cm wavelength), during the austral spring of 1989, obtaining a brightness temperature, T(CMB), of 2.64 +/- 0.07 K (68% confidence level). The new result is in agreement with our previous measurements at the same frequency obtained in 1986-88 from a very different site and has comparable error bars. Combining measurements from all years we obtain T(CMB) = 2.64 +/- 0.06 K.
